Using Affiliate Marketing on Online Marketing Strategies
| |
| Many experts recognize the role of affiliate marketing in online marketing strategies. It adds value to the business domain and maximizes the potential revenues. There are two parties involved in Affiliate Marketing.
The first party is a website owner who lends his web pages or business domain for advertisements of products and services owned by an online merchant, the second party. Affiliate marketing drives traffic to your website and widens your market. |

How to Find Your Ideal Client
| |
| Nearly every client I have says their perfect client is “everyone” because “I can help everyone” or “My book can help everyone.”
That might be wonderful but it is bad business. You can’t afford to market to “everyone.” And “everyone” doesn’t want you. They want to work with someone who specializes in “them,” not in everyone.
That’s why I was delighted when I signed a new coaching client who works with lawyers who are in a certain transition point in their careers and must make career and life choices. How cool is that! |

A Means to an End
| |
| One of the most stressful moments for most sales people comes at the point when they have to decide whether or not to go around someone they have been dealing with to that point, be they client or prospect.
There are a number of factors in determining if and when to do an end run in order to win a deal. The value of the product/solution to the client organization; how pervasive is your solution in the client’s organization; how the client goes about purchasing both in terms of deciding and executing the purchase. And most notably, how good the rep is to begin with. |

Coaching and Psychological Styles: Adjust Your Approach!
| |
| Most coaches understand, intuitively, the need to adjust their approach in dealing with different types of clients, but quite often, these adjustments don’t come until it’s too late, and the client has already lost faith in the process. Using an assessment to determine a client’s Perceptual Style at the outset of the coaching relationship can shift the equation, giving the coach the tools he/she needs to connect with the client and speak that client’s language right away. |
